Optical properties and preparation of Bismuth Titanate (Bi12TiO20) using combustion synthesis technique

Resumo

Bismuth Titanate (Bi12TiO20) with sillenite structures was prepared by combustion synthesis method with urea as fuel at much lower calcination temperature due to which volatilization of bismuth can be minimized. The complete phase formation in the as prepared samples was confirmed by X-ray diffraction (XRD) studies. Surface morphology of the powders were studied using scanning electron microscope (SEM). Chemical analysis of the powder was done with the help of TG-DTA studies. Its optical properties were studied with the help of UV–visible absorption spectra, and photoluminescence spectroscopy (PL).
